MUSEUM OF ARTS & SCIENCES INC, founded in 1956, is a community n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$2.5M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 61%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$933K, a strong 37% operating margin.

Mission

OUR MISSION IS TO STIMULATE CURIOSITY, EVOKE WONDER, AND INSPIRE LIFELONG LEARNING THROUGH DYNAMIC EXPERIENCES THAT UNITE ARTS AND SCIENCES. WE ENVISION A COMMUNITY STRENGTHENED BY INQUIRY, EXPRESSION, AND INNOVATION.
